  Robert
Hudson
For the last four decades, Robert Hudson has been known for his large-scale welded-steel and poly-chromed steel and bronze sculptures. The San Francisco Bay area artist has also produced a large body of paintings and drawings during a distinguished career. Based in the assemblage sculpture and Funk movements in California during the late 1950s and 1960s, Hudson has consistently presented spatially and formally complex work, most often characterized by found objects, wit and irony.

Hudson has exhibited since 1961, and his work is included in The Art Institute of Chicago, the Museum of Fine Arts, Boston, The Museum of Modern Art, The Philadelphia Museum of Art, the San Francisco Museum of Modern Art and the Stedelijk Museum. Writing about earlier Hudson ceramic work, the critic Peter Schjeldahl has noted:

“There is a kind of dreamlike abstract logic to these works, a blend of non-chalance and inevitability that can be best understood, I believe, in terms of a radical coming to grips with the medium.”
